Towards Tracking of Deep Brain Stimulation Electrodes Using an Integrated Magnetometer.

Summary

This study introduces a magnetic tracking system for deep brain stimulation (DBS) surgery. The system enhances surgical precision by monitoring electrode position, potentially improving outcomes for movement disorder treatments.
